Bounce is often a bengaluru-dependent startup that is popular in ride sharing and bike rentals. The Infinity E1 is Bounce’s first electric scooter featuring in the state. The Infinity E1 is available in two different variants �?the minimal variant Infinity E1 without the battery pack and the very best variant Infinity E1 with the battery pack. The scooter will come with two modes �?the power as well as eco power mode, that deliver the best possible safety to your rider. Powered by a 2kWh lithium-ion battery pack, it offers a Accredited range of 85km per charge and may sprint from 0 to 40kph electric scooters 15000w electric bike in just 8 seconds!

Unagi leverages TORAY carbon fiber from Japan to strike an unparalleled balance of lightweight and heavy-duty toughness. The composite is anisotropic, a technical term meaning it’s laid down by hand inside of a painstaking process that optimizes strength by distributing levels of your fiber where it’s needed most.
